How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Alameda Corridor?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Alameda Corridor Studio Apartments | $1,957 | $1,850 | $2,072 |
Alameda Corridor 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,128 | $1,850 | $2,851 |
Alameda Corridor 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,603 | $2,165 | $3,744 |
Alameda Corridor 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,242 | $2,630 | $3,879 |
Alameda Corridor 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,500 | $4,500 | $4,500 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Alameda Corridor
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Alameda Corridor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Alameda Corridor ranges from $1,850 to $2,851 with an average monthly rent of $2,128.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Alameda Corridor c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Alameda Corridor range from $2,165 to $3,744.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,603.
